HAMPSHIRE students have celebrated the end of term with a special exhibition showcasing their artistic talents.
Foundation art students at Barton Peveril College exhibited their final major projects of photography, fine art, moving images, fashion, 3D, illustrations, textiles and graphic design in front of their parents, teachers and peers.
This year 59 students have earned themselves a place at university, with some going to Mackintosh Glasgow School of Art, Central St Martins, London College of Fashion, Goldsmiths, Camberwell and the Ruskin School of Oxford University.
Course leader Rob French said: “It is astonishing to reflect on how far, through their own hard work, these creative young people have come since last September.
“It has been an absolute pleasure to know and work with them and we wish our class of 2015 all the very best for the future.”
